Kasich names treasurer for 2010 campaign against Strickland (Joe Hallett, 5/01/09, THE COLUMBUS DISPATCH )

Republican John Kasich filed papers this afternoon so that he can begin raising money for the 2010 race for governor.

In a filing with the Ohio secretary of state, the former congressman from Westerville designated Bradley K. Sinnott, chairman of the Franklin County GOP Central Committee, as treasurer of Kasich for Ohio, Kasich's gubernatorial campaign. The move will permit Kasich to raise cash and hire staff for his anticipated campaign against Democratic Gov. Ted Strickland.

"We're off and running," said a source who has been helping Kasich prepare for a gubernatorial bid.
